Ik wil jullie graag leren hoe je een Tutorial of een Release schrijft/maakt. Dit doe ik omdat ik een aantal Tutorials of Releases heb gezien die mij totaal niet duidelijk waren. (als er eentje van mij niet duidelijk is moet je het gewoon zeggen ). Ik ga deze tut in tweeën opsplitsen. Namelijk hier het gedeelte over Tutorials en in de eerste post het gedeelte over Releases. Het meeste dat in deze Tutorial wordt uitgelegd zie je hier ook terug.
Hoe schrijf ik een Tutorial?
Als eerste moet je bedenken waarover je een Tutorial wilt schrijven. Wat wil je de mensen leren en heb je zelf genoeg ervaring met je onderwerp. Kijk ook andere (goede) Tutorials door om te kijken hoe zij ze opbouwen.
Dan moet je natuurlijk een Duidelijke titel hebben. Niet dat als je een tut ga schrijven over commands dat je dit bijvoorbeeld als titel doe : "[tut] hoe maak je bijvoorbeeld /kill". Dit nodigt niet uit tot lezen. Nu denken mensen dat jij een beginner bent die eigenlijk al niet weet waar hij over praat. Terwijl je inhoud gewoon perfect kan zijn.
Als begin vinden mensen het fijn als je een goede inleiding heb, waarin je vragen beantwoord zoals:
- Als je nog niet zo bekend bent willen mensen wel weten wie je bent en hoeveel ervaring je met scripten heb.
- Waarom schrijf je deze tut?
- Hoe ben je op het idee gekomen?
- Wat wil je de mensen leren?
Je onderwerp introduceren.
Daaronder maak je een klein tussenkopje zodat alles er netjes en georganiseerd uitziet. Hier ga je je onderwerp introduceren. Dit houdt in dat je ga vertellen wat je onderwerp precies is. Als je bijvoorbeeld een dialoog als onderwerp neemt laat je een (paar) screenshot(s) zien van een dialoog. Verder ga je ze vertellen wat het eindrultaat moet worden en als je extra includes gebruikt geef je hier linkjes naar de downloadplek daarvan of vermeld je duidelijk dat de links onderaan staan. Vermeld wel duidelijk de namen van de makers erbij.
Beginnen met je "lessen".
Dit stuk moet jij helemaal zelf bepalen. Hier begin jij met je les. In een Tutorial is het de bedoeling dat je alles zo goed en duidelijk mogelijk uitlegt. Denk er wel om dat je alle tijd heb. Als je je Tutorial niet op kan slaan, sla je je text op in een kladblok bestand en open je hem weer als je tijd heb. Zorg er ook voor dat er niet te veel overbodige informatie instaat. Zoals hele stukjes met eigen ervaringen. Als mensen jou onderwerp willen leren begrijpen hoeven ze geen eigen verhaaltjes ertussendoor te lezen. Hooguit een klein grappig zinnetje. Als laatste van dit stuk vinden mensen het fijn als je goed ABN (Algemeen Beschaafd Nederlands) schrijft, zodat iedereen het kan begrijpen. (nu zei ik wel dat je dit stuk helemaal zelf moest verzinnen maar nog is dit het langste stukje van alle XD) <---dit is eigenlijk al te lang.
Je Tutorial eindigen.
Nu je klaar bent kun je beginnen met je einde. Hier vinden mensen het leuk om te lezen of jij zelf ook wat heb geleerd. Ook heel belangrijk is dat je hier nog een aantal downloads zet. Sommige mensen willen niet de hele tut lezen en alleen gebruik maken van hetgeen wat jij heb gemaakt. Dus zet je bijvoorbeeld een script met alle losse stukjes code die je in je Tutorial heb gezet (kan je het best op pastebin.com of plaatscode.be zetten) en een extraatje is als je het als in een filterscript zet zodat het meteen klaar voor gebruik is. Let er dan wel op dat als je een Filterscript staat dat je naam bovenin bij "main()" staat. Anders kunnen andere mensen het op hun eigen naam gaan releasen. Dan heb jij er namelijk geen auteursrechten op gezet.
Het einde van het einde.
Helemaal onderaan vermeld je duidelijk maar simpel alle namen van de personen die aan het script hebben meegewerkt.
Tutorial Check.
Nu ben je klaar om op het "Post new Topic" knopje te drukken. Vervolgens haal je alles wat je in de tutorial heb gezet uit je script en uit je servermap. Zet dit allemaal ergens in een mapje op je bureaublad of ergens waar je het makkelijk kan vinden. Nu ga je je hele Tutorial uitvoeren alsof je een beginner bent en dit zo'n beetje je eerste Tutorial is die je leest. Dit doe je wel in je server map (of een kopie daarvan waar je dus ook eerst alles uit heb gehaalt). 9 van de 10 keer stuit je op fouten of moet er nog iets bijgezet worden. herhaal dit net zo vaak totdat alles werkt en je hele Tutorial er netjes uitziet en helemaal compleet is.
Het einde van dit stuk van de Tutorial.
Ik hoop dat mensen hier veel van hebben geleerd en dat we nu geen tutorials meer krijgen die alleen zeggen "zet dit stuk daar neer en klaar". Nu ik terugkijk op "oude" (nog steeds wel de meest recente van dit gedeelte van het forum) Tutorials van mij zie ik dat er ook wel het een en ander aan verbeterd kan worden.
[TUT] Hoe Schrijf je een Tutorial/Release.
De Tutorial
Hallo,
Ik wil jullie graag leren hoe je een Tutorial of een Release schrijft/maakt. Dit doe ik omdat ik een aantal Tutorials of Releases heb gezien die mij totaal niet duidelijk waren. (als er eentje van mij niet duidelijk is moet je het gewoon zeggen
). Ik ga deze tut in tweeën opsplitsen. Namelijk hier het gedeelte over Tutorials en in de eerste post het gedeelte over Releases. Het meeste dat in deze Tutorial wordt uitgelegd zie je hier ook terug.
Hoe schrijf ik een Tutorial?
Als eerste moet je bedenken waarover je een Tutorial wilt schrijven. Wat wil je de mensen leren en heb je zelf genoeg ervaring met je onderwerp. Kijk ook andere (goede) Tutorials door om te kijken hoe zij ze opbouwen.
Dan moet je natuurlijk een Duidelijke titel hebben. Niet dat als je een tut ga schrijven over commands dat je dit bijvoorbeeld als titel doe : "[tut] hoe maak je bijvoorbeeld /kill". Dit nodigt niet uit tot lezen. Nu denken mensen dat jij een beginner bent die eigenlijk al niet weet waar hij over praat. Terwijl je inhoud gewoon perfect kan zijn.
Als begin vinden mensen het fijn als je een goede inleiding heb, waarin je vragen beantwoord zoals:
- Als je nog niet zo bekend bent willen mensen wel weten wie je bent en hoeveel ervaring je met scripten heb.
- Waarom schrijf je deze tut?
- Hoe ben je op het idee gekomen?
- Wat wil je de mensen leren?
Je onderwerp introduceren.
Daaronder maak je een klein tussenkopje zodat alles er netjes en georganiseerd uitziet. Hier ga je je onderwerp introduceren. Dit houdt in dat je ga vertellen wat je onderwerp precies is. Als je bijvoorbeeld een dialoog als onderwerp neemt laat je een (paar) screenshot(s) zien van een dialoog. Verder ga je ze vertellen wat het eindrultaat moet worden en als je extra includes gebruikt geef je hier linkjes naar de downloadplek daarvan of vermeld je duidelijk dat de links onderaan staan. Vermeld wel duidelijk de namen van de makers erbij.
Beginnen met je "lessen".
Dit stuk moet jij helemaal zelf bepalen. Hier begin jij met je les. In een Tutorial is het de bedoeling dat je alles zo goed en duidelijk mogelijk uitlegt. Denk er wel om dat je alle tijd heb. Als je je Tutorial niet op kan slaan, sla je je text op in een kladblok bestand en open je hem weer als je tijd heb. Zorg er ook voor dat er niet te veel overbodige informatie instaat. Zoals hele stukjes met eigen ervaringen. Als mensen jou onderwerp willen leren begrijpen hoeven ze geen eigen verhaaltjes ertussendoor te lezen. Hooguit een klein grappig zinnetje. Als laatste van dit stuk vinden mensen het fijn als je goed ABN (Algemeen Beschaafd Nederlands) schrijft, zodat iedereen het kan begrijpen. (nu zei ik wel dat je dit stuk helemaal zelf moest verzinnen maar nog is dit het langste stukje van alle XD) <---dit is eigenlijk al te lang.
Je Tutorial eindigen.
Nu je klaar bent kun je beginnen met je einde. Hier vinden mensen het leuk om te lezen of jij zelf ook wat heb geleerd. Ook heel belangrijk is dat je hier nog een aantal downloads zet. Sommige mensen willen niet de hele tut lezen en alleen gebruik maken van hetgeen wat jij heb gemaakt. Dus zet je bijvoorbeeld een script met alle losse stukjes code die je in je Tutorial heb gezet (kan je het best op pastebin.com of plaatscode.be zetten) en een extraatje is als je het als in een filterscript zet zodat het meteen klaar voor gebruik is. Let er dan wel op dat als je een Filterscript staat dat je naam bovenin bij "main()" staat. Anders kunnen andere mensen het op hun eigen naam gaan releasen. Dan heb jij er namelijk geen auteursrechten op gezet.
Het einde van het einde.
Helemaal onderaan vermeld je duidelijk maar simpel alle namen van de personen die aan het script hebben meegewerkt.
Tutorial Check.
Nu ben je klaar om op het "Post new Topic" knopje te drukken. Vervolgens haal je alles wat je in de tutorial heb gezet uit je script en uit je servermap. Zet dit allemaal ergens in een mapje op je bureaublad of ergens waar je het makkelijk kan vinden. Nu ga je je hele Tutorial uitvoeren alsof je een beginner bent en dit zo'n beetje je eerste Tutorial is die je leest. Dit doe je wel in je server map (of een kopie daarvan waar je dus ook eerst alles uit heb gehaalt). 9 van de 10 keer stuit je op fouten of moet er nog iets bijgezet worden. herhaal dit net zo vaak totdat alles werkt en je hele Tutorial er netjes uitziet en helemaal compleet is.
Het einde van dit stuk van de Tutorial.
Ik hoop dat mensen hier veel van hebben geleerd en dat we nu geen tutorials meer krijgen die alleen zeggen "zet dit stuk daar neer en klaar". Nu ik terugkijk op "oude" (nog steeds wel de meest recente van dit gedeelte van het forum) Tutorials van mij zie ik dat er ook wel het een en ander aan verbeterd kan worden.
©Morph1
Bewerkt: door Morph1